How do you mute the ringer on a landline phone?
To mute the ringer on a landline phone, look for a button on the phone that has a bell with a line through it, or the word 'mute' next to it. Pressing this button will silence the ringer so that the phone does not ring when someone calls. If your phone does not have a specific mute button, look for a volume control that can turn the ringer all the way down to zero.
If you are unable to find a mute or volume control on your phone, consult the user manual or contact the manufacturer for assistance. Keep in mind that muting the ringer on your phone will only silence incoming calls, and will not affect your ability to make outgoing calls.
